According to psychology experts, sexual fantasies are often influenced by childhood experiences, traumas, and unresolved emotional issues that shape our adult behavior.
If you grew up feeling rejected or neglected by your parents, you may be more likely to fantasize about being dominated or controlled during sex. On the other hand, if you felt loved and cherished as a child, you may be drawn to more tender and nurturing experiences. Similarly, if you had a strict upbringing, you may desire freedom and independence in your sexual life. The same goes for relationship patterns - if you've experienced abuse, betrayal, or abandonment in past relationships, you may project these insecurities onto your current partners through your sexual fantasies.
Fantasies also reflect our deepest desires and needs, which may not always align with what we feel comfortable expressing.
Some people may want to engage in BDSM activities but feel ashamed or guilty because of societal norms or religious beliefs. Others may crave non-monogamous relationships, yet fear rejection or stigma from their family or friends. These hidden desires often manifest in our fantasy world where anything is possible, allowing us to explore our darker sides without judgment.
It's important to remember that sexual fantasies don't necessarily predict real-life behavior. They serve as a way to process our thoughts and feelings, helping us understand ourselves better and prepare for future encounters.
